回答編集履歴
1
コメントを追加
answer
CHANGED
@@ -9,9 +9,13 @@
|
|
9
9
|
SVGの`linarGradient`, `radialGradient`要素で定義したグラデーションであれば, それらをSVGの図形要素にCSSから指定することは可能です.
|
10
10
|
が, CSSのグラデーション機構(`linear-gradient`関数等)を直接SVGの図形要素に適用することは残念ながらできません.
|
11
11
|
|
12
|
+
NOTE:
|
13
|
+
一般にSVGにおいて**プレゼンテーション属性**と呼ばれている属性については, CSSから値を指定することが可能です. プレゼンテーション属性としては`fill`, `stroke`, `stroke-width`, `stroke-linecap`等があります.
|
14
|
+
|
12
15
|
例:
|
13
16
|
```CSS
|
14
17
|
path{
|
18
|
+
/*fillはプレゼンテーション属性なので, CSSから値を指定できる*/
|
15
19
|
fill: url(#g);
|
16
20
|
}
|
17
21
|
```
|